    I was looking for KDE music players. Only Amarok and Elisa are KDE projects out of the ones you listed. KDE's six music players (yes I found another one) are Amarok, AudioTube, Elisa, JuK, Soundcloud Player for Plasma Bigscreen (great name) and Vvave. Source: over 1 year ago
